Facilities Ticket — Cleaning Crew Access, Brindle Annex

For new starters handling evening lock-up: the Sorano Cleaning crew arrives nightly at 21:30 via the annex side door. Check their rota sheet, note arrival in the log, and ensure the storeroom is relocked afterward. To let them through the side door, enter the access code below.

badge for yaweg-hafog: bdg-GX-6

### PR: Harden turnstile counter aggregation

This change moves the Westfold Arena turnstile counter from per-gate polling to signed batch uploads. Counts are now monotonic per device, with replay detection keyed on a rolling nonce window. Security-relevant effects: tampered batches are dropped and logged, and clock skew tolerance is explicit rather than implicit. The tuning constants governing these checks are listed here.

tuning table, yajog-yahof:
BUDGETS = {
    "lamvan": 303,
    "wenox": 460,
    "fenvan": 525,
}

### Changelog — v2.9.0: New load-test defaults

We bumped the default settings for the Cartwheel checkout load tests after last quarter's runs kept flaking under realistic traffic. Ramp-up is gentler now and think-time is actually modeled, so numbers should stop lying to us. The new defaults shipped with this release are listed below.

deployment values, yadup-kadug:
[sorys]
port = 5672
team = noveth
host = sorys.orvexcorp.example
region = south-4
access_code = ac_deddc1
timeout_ms = 1500